How often are you consciously grateful?

Most people are well aware that gratefulness, gratitude, and thankfulness are all powerful states of being. The phrase “develop an attitude of gratitude” was even popular for a while.

But it turns out that while most people are aware of gratitude, few practice it.

Try writing a list of things you feel gratitude for at the end of each day. It just takes a couple of minutes.

Or when someone asks you “How’s business?” respond by telling them, and then follow that by telling them that you are really grateful for it.

Or silently say to yourself “thank you” when something nice happens for you.

Or …. (you’ve probably already thought of another way to express gratitude).

The powerful, positive effect of consciously being in frequent gratitude may astound you!

 

Coaching Point: Are you even willing to be grateful for the parts of your life that are not the way you want? When you are it sure makes it easier to change them.
